How the numbers stack up
Amado's all-time total is 13x the median boys name, and Liam still leads by a wide margin.
| Metric | Amado | Median boys name (Takari) | #1 boys name (Liam) |
|---|---|---|---|
| All-time total births | 4,769 | 369 | 358,536 |
| Peak-year births | 176 | 34 | 22,252 |
Amado's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Splitting Amado's full recorded timeline at 1968, 66%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 34% in the earlier half -- usage has skewed toward the present, not a one-decade spike. Its quietest year on record was 1883, with just 5 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 2025 peak of 176 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.

Amado by state
Where Amado concentrates geographically, total births since 1883
| Rank | State | Visual share | Births | Share of total |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| #1 | Texas | | 1,763 | 37.0% |
| #2 | California | | 1,021 | 21.4% |
| #3 | New York | | 67 | 1.4% |
| #4 | Arizona | | 53 | 1.1% |
| #5 | Illinois | | 47 | 1.0% |
| #6 | Florida | | 31 | 0.7% |
| #7 | Washington | | 24 | 0.5% |
| #8 | New Mexico | | 16 | 0.3% |
1,763 of 4,769 births nationwide. Compared to a flat distribution across 13 reporting states.
